A while back, the Luken MUX on SES-2 moved to Eutelsat 113 satellite. When these channels were on SES-2, I got all of them, but now on several of these channels, all I have is a black screen and no audio. These channels aren't encrypted. This is on my GTMedia V8 Blue STB. I've re-scanned the satellite, nothing.

I deleted all the channels and did a re-scan, still nothing. I deleted all the transponders and re-scanned again, these channels are still not coming in. I know the channels are still working because I've ask others doing FTA and they're getting them just fine. I don't know what to try next. Any suggestions?

Most of those come in fine for me (just checked) on my V8 Nova Orange

4040 V 30000 --- Retro TV, Action, Family, Heartland, etc come in fine but some of the locals are black screen right now.

Retro Channel is showing a black and white movie (Signal is 84 and Quality is 72) for me.

Maybe your LNB needs a tweak.

Yes H.265.
But I had issues with media files in H.265, some had a different screen size, a few lines less than normal, and would not play.

Later software fixed this.
